Lock Upp Season 2 Highlights Contestant Conflicts and Kangana Ranaut's Jury Role
Lock Upp Season 2 features intense interactions among contestants, with Akanksha Chamola accusing Shreya Kalra of betrayal, leading to emotional confrontations and social media reactions. Kangana Ranaut, appearing as jury, criticized contestants like Yogesh Rawat for alleged cheating and Riyaz Aly for inflated social media followers. Shreya faced allegations of orchestrating negative PR campaigns. Meanwhile, Dheeraj Dhoopar was noted for lacking 'main character energy,' with his wife defending him. Hosts Farah Khan and Riteish Deshmukh were praised for their fair and firm approach.
